1930s Original French Art Deco Travel Poster, Saint-Etienne (Village de Cornillon) gamble On the bottom it isDate: 1930s Size: 24. 25 x 39. 5 inches About The Poster: A fabulous Art Deco poster by the incomparable Rogers Broders. Broders was a French illustrator best known for his travel posters promoting tourist destinations in France, both on the Cote d'Azur as well as in the French Alps.
